Well at first before I come to Istana Budaya, I was doubt with the level of satisfaction of the show. But then they did not disappoint me. They were like use different approach this time and it is their very first time performing by acoustic and other Borneo's rare instrument. They changed a bit their songs but it really satisfied all of the audience inside the room. Even though got some parts were like, salah main, terkantoi, salah timing and Radhi forgot the lyrics, but then I was really satisfied with the show.
They played the old songs (minus the 60's TV), Generasiku, Ikhlust, Creepie Crawlies, Nowwhy2, Slumber, Beautifool, etc. and of course the new single, British di Bawah Tanah Air and they covered Oasis's Dont Look Back in Anger and yeah, awesome!
